What is Gliden?
Gliden is an oral medication used to control blood sugar levels in people with type 2 diabetes. It stimulates the pancreas to release more insulin, helping to lower blood glucose levels and prevent complications related to diabetes.

What is the usual dose of Gliden?
The usual adult dose ranges from 40 mg to 320 mg daily, often divided into one or two doses. Extended-release formulations are taken once daily. It is not recommended for children.

How do I take Gliden?
Take Gliden as prescribed, usually with food to avoid low blood sugar. Do not skip meals while using this medicine. Avoid alcohol, as it can affect blood sugar levels.

What is Gliden used for?
Gliden is used to control high blood sugar levels in patients with type 2 diabetes, reducing the risk of complications like nerve damage, kidney disease, and heart problems.

How long does it take for Gliden to start working?
Gliden begins to lower blood sugar levels within a few hours of taking a dose. Full effects on blood sugar control may take a few days to weeks.

Is Gliden effective?
Yes, studies show that Gliden effectively reduces blood sugar levels and improves long-term diabetes management when combined with diet and exercise.

How does one know if Gliden is working?
Improved blood sugar readings and reduced diabetes-related symptoms like excessive thirst and fatigue indicate the medicine is working. Regular tests, such as HbA1c, help monitor progress.

How does Gliden work?
Gliden stimulates the pancreas to release more insulin, which helps lower blood sugar levels. It also improves blood flow by reducing clot formation.

Who should avoid taking Gliden?
Avoid Gliden if you have type 1 diabetes, severe liver or kidney problems, or a history of allergic reactions to sulfonylureas. Pregnant or breastfeeding women should consult their doctor before use.

Can I take Gliden with other prescription drugs?
Gliden interacts with several drugs, including insulin, blood thinners, and certain antibiotics, which may enhance or reduce its effects. Always inform your doctor about all medications you're using.

Can Gliden be taken safely while pregnant?
Gliden is generally not recommended during pregnancy. Insulin is often a safer alternative. Discuss with your doctor if you are pregnant or planning to conceive.

Can Gliden be taken safely while breastfeeding?
It is not usually recommended while breastfeeding, as it may pass into breast milk and affect the baby. Consult your doctor for alternatives.

Is Gliden safe for the elderly?
Yes, but elderly patients should be closely monitored, as they are more prone to hypoglycemia and its effects. Dose adjustments may be necessary.

Does Gliden make people tired or drowsy?
Gliden does not directly cause drowsiness, but low blood sugar from the medication can lead to fatigue or confusion. Monitor blood sugar levels and report persistent symptoms to your doctor.

Does Gliden cause stomach upset?
Yes, Gliden may cause nausea, abdominal discomfort, or diarrhea in some individuals. Taking it with food can help. Contact your doctor if symptoms persist.

Does Gliden affect sleep?
Gliden is not known to affect sleep directly. However, symptoms of low blood sugar at night may disrupt sleep. Monitor your sugar levels before bedtime.

Does Gliden make it hard to think or concentrate?
Low blood sugar caused by Gliden can result in difficulty concentrating, confusion, or dizziness. If these symptoms occur, eat or drink something sugary and contact your doctor if needed.

Does Gliden affect mood?
Mood changes are not common but may occur due to blood sugar fluctuations. If you notice persistent mood swings, consult your doctor for guidance.

Does Gliden interfere with sexual function?
Gliden is not directly linked to sexual dysfunction. However, uncontrolled blood sugar levels can impact sexual health. Managing diabetes may improve overall function.

Does Gliden affect appetite?
Gliden may increase appetite in some individuals, leading to weight gain. Focus on a healthy, balanced diet to manage this effect.

Does Gliden cause weight gain?
Yes, weight gain is a possible side effect due to increased insulin production and appetite. Regular exercise and a healthy diet can help minimize this effect.

Does Gliden cause headaches?
Headaches can occur with Gliden, often due to low blood sugar levels. Ensure regular meals and snacks to prevent hypoglycemia-related headaches.

Does Gliden limit driving?
Low blood sugar caused by Gliden can impair focus and reaction time, affecting driving. Always check your blood sugar before driving and carry a quick source of sugar.

Is it safe to drink alcohol while taking Gliden?
Alcohol can increase the risk of low blood sugar. Limit alcohol intake, and never drink on an empty stomach while taking Gliden. Always consult your doctor for advice.

Is it safe to drink coffee or tea while taking Gliden?
Coffee and tea are generally safe, but excessive caffeine may affect blood sugar levels. Monitor your intake and discuss any concerns with your doctor.

Is it safe to exercise while taking Gliden?
Yes, exercise is beneficial for managing diabetes. However, monitor blood sugar levels, especially before and after exercising, to prevent hypoglycemia while on Gliden.

What are Gliden possible harms and risks?
Common side effects include low blood sugar (hypoglycemia), nausea, headache, and weight gain. Rarely, serious side effects like liver issues or blood disorders can occur. Contact a doctor if you experience persistent symptoms or severe side effects.
